John M. Andrews

A Series of Works

John M. Andrews is an abstract painter based in southern Maine. He earned a Bachelor of Fine Arts from the Rochester Institute of Technology in 1972 and has continued his artistic development through numerous workshops and study groups. 

Andrews has exhibited extensively across Maine for several decades, including shows with the Ogunquit Art Association and at galleries such as Elizabeth Moss Galleries and the Barn Gallery. His career includes solo exhibitions, juried shows, and long-standing involvement in the regional arts community. 

In addition to exhibiting, he has contributed to the arts through teaching, mentoring, and community engagement since the late 1980s.
